And where we begin, potential military intervention.
President Trump says he is monitoring protests in Iran and considering several options.
Two officials tell CNN that includes striking the Iranian regime if the regime kills protesters.
Tehran is intensifying a very violent crackdown on anti-government protests.
In the past 15 days, more than 500 protesters have been killed and 10,000 arrested.
This morning, large crowds are gathering for Iran to support the regime.
